Rezidua farmak v životním prostředí - interakce s vyššími rostlinami / Residua of Drugs in the Evironment - Interaction with Higher Plants

Jirák, Jaroslav January 2016 (has links)
- 4 - Abstract The aim of this study was to carry out phytoextraction experiments using corn plants (Zea mays) and determine the phytoextraction efficiency for specific non-steroidal anti- inflammatory drugs and carbamazepine and their combinations. After 10 days of growth, a nutrient solution containing ibuprofene, naproxene, diclofenac and carbamazepine in concentrations ranging from 5 to 10 mg/L was added to hydrophonically cultivated plants. Nutrient solution samples were taken every 24 hours and the samples were then analysed using a HPLC/DAD system. At the end of the experiment, the experimental plants and roots were analysed for extractable residua using HPLC/DAD + FLD. The greatest phytoextraction efficiency was found for ibuprofene. The second and third most effective extraction was observed for naproxene and diclofenac, depending on the evaluation criteria. The lowest phytoextraction efficiency was observed for carbamazepine. With multi-component experiments, lower phytoextraction efficiency was found out for all substances with the exception of ibuprofene in combination with diclofenac and carbamazepine. Ocenění společnosti FARMAK, a.s. / The Valuation of the company FARMAK, a.s.

Valderová, Lenka January 2013 (has links)
The diploma thesis is dealing with the valuation of the Compaq FARMAK, a.s. and it is created for potential investors. The company evaluation refers to December 4, 2013. The beginning of the thesis is related to the theoretical part, where methods used in the practical part are described. In the first instance, there is financial analysis of financial statements performed. The analysis has three elements -- vertical analysis, horizontal analysis and ratio analysis. Then the strategic analysis is performed with its analysis of micro and macro environment. Then financial plan was planned based on previous analyses and prognosis of value generators. The valuation of the company is using yield method of discounted free cash flow. -- FCFF and then the value is compared with the accounting value of the company.
